How do I fix a Mac startup disk full error?

How to free up space on your Mac startup disk

  1. Empty the Trash and Downloads folder.
  2. Get rid of Time Machine snapshots.
  3. Delete old iOS and iPadOS backups.
  4. Uninstall apps you don’t use anymore.
  5. Upload or export your largest files.
  6. Find and remove duplicate files.
  7. Clean up unnecessary system files.

Why is my Mac saying my disk is full when it’s not?

Once “Your disk is almost full” notification pops up on a screen, it’s time to do some work. Running low on storage might cause your Mac to slow down or behave strangely. This usually happens if you have too many outdated files, old logs, caches, and apps you no longer use.

How do you delete files on a Mac when the disk is full?

Open a Finder window and select the file or folder you want to delete. Hold option and go to File > Delete Immediately. In the pop-up window, confirm you want to delete the item.

What does startup disk mean Mac?

The startup disk is the hard drive where your computer’s operating system and applications are installed. This is usually a hard drive that is physically inside your Mac.

How do I check the startup disk on my Mac?

On your Mac, choose Apple menu > System Preferences. Click Startup Disk . Your selected startup disk is shown at the top of the preferences pane.

How do I close startup disk on Mac?

Startup Disk: Set the startup disk for the Mac. Choose Apple menu > Startup Disk. To quit the app, choose Startup Disk > Quit Startup Disk.

What does a full startup disk warning mean?

Inevitably, a full startup disk warning as such comes up on your MacBook Pro/Air, iMac, Mac Mini at some point. It indicates that you are running out of storage of the startup disk, which should be taken seriously, because a (almost) full startup disk will slow down your Mac and in extreme cases, the Mac won’t start when startup disc was full.

What does it mean when your disk is almost full?

When you are seeing this “your startup disk is almost full” messages, it means that your MacBook or iMac is running on low space and you should clear your startup disk as soon as possible. Or the Mac will be acting weirdly because there is no enough storage space, such as getting intolerably slow, apps crashing unexpectedly.
